ALIMI EXTENDS GENEROSITY TOWARDS OFFIN-ILE, ORETA AND BAIYEKU COMMUNITIES. | Shakiru Seidu

In preparation towards the forth coming Local Governments election, all aspiring candidates are beginning to canvass and galvanize votes from the people. On Sunday, 2nd of July, 2017, Hon. Nurudeen Alimi, (APC ward C3 councillorship candidate) wooed the support of the youths as he made donations of sporting materials to the football teams of OFFIN/ORETA and BAIYEKU.
